Nov 09 '07, King Salmon, Humboldt


I should've hit the rocks earlier, but sometimes I'm lazy. I finally got out to the north rocks at 2:15ish. It had been sunny all day, but when I got out there it was gettin a little overcasty. The tide was low and still goin, but nice and calm. I started at the tip, like usual. Pitchin my 5" Offshore Angler XPS Salt water Twintail Shad, green/chart. tail, I started workin the rocks. I also brought my ultra light spinnin rod w/ 4lb line and a drop shot rigged 3" Berkley Bass Minnow. I didn't get a hit until about 3:30, quite aways off the tip. The tide was gettin really low and small swells started poundin the rocks and stirring up the sand. I felt a small tug and got hugely excited. I dropped it in the same hole again for another missed tug. A third drop went untouched. When a sequence like this happens I work the holes immediately next to it. This is because the fish has become annoyed and move. The next hole was basically the same sequence. The next hole started the same, but I was able to bring up a small Black Rocky this time. Unfortunately it jumped off the hook at the surface of the water. I kept workin down with no more hits until a little after 4:30 when I called it.blankstare
